The Regional Offices (ROs) of the Department of Education (DepEd) have been instructed to make sure that the P5,000 cash allowance for teachers to be used in the upcoming school year is released "as soon as possible.

As stated in the advisory, DepEd said that the P5,000 cash allowance is given to classroom teachers for the “purchase of teaching supplies and materials, for internet subscription, and other communication expenses.”

DepEd added that the said allowance is also intended for the “annual medical expense” for SY 2022-2023.

In DepEd Order No. 10 s. of 2020, it was noted that the cash allowance “shall be given to entitled public school teachers not earlier than the official start of the school year.:

“In exigency of the service of the entire teaching force,” DepEd said that the P5,000 cash allowance for implementing units of DepEd which have available cash allowance “shall release/pay eligible teachers” not earlier than Aug. 22, 2022, which was announced as the first day of classes for the incoming school year.
